Jackson, Tennessee

Jackson, Tennessee, in Madison county, is 76 miles NE of Memphis, Tennessee. The city has a population of 59,643.

The People and Families of Jackson

In Jackson, about 44% of adults are married.

There is an unusually large share of women in Jackson.

Wealth and Education

In 2000, Jackson had a median family income of $40,922. To its credit, the people in Jackson value education and a large proportion are college graduates.

Political Inclinations

In the 2004 election, George W. Bush was the top Presidential fund-raiser in Jackson ($26,635). Residents gave more to the Democratic party than any of the others.

Jackson Housing

About 57% of housing units in Jackson are owner-occupied. People in the city pay more in property taxes per residence than in most communities in the state.

Commuting

In Jackson, 94% of commuters drive to work. Commuting to work is generally easier in Jackson than in most places of its size.

Did You Know? ...
Interesting Facts and Statistics:

In the past, very few of the milligrams found in a ?bag? or single dose were likely to be heroin as most of the bag was filled with such additives as milk sugar, powdered milk, or quinine.

Sudden Sniffing Death Syndrome is fatal and has been known to occur to first time inhalant users.

According to 2005 DEA statistics, New York state, with a population exceeding 19,000,000, had 35 Meth Lab Incidents. North Dakota, population 636,677 had 159 for the same year, Nebraska had 224 and Iowa had 753!

According to the University of Michigan.s Monitoring the Future Study in 2002, 1.6% of 8th graders, 1.8% of 10th graders, and 1.7% of 12th graders surveyed reported using heroin at least once during their lifetime. That study also showed that 0.9% of 8th graders, 1.1% of 10th graders, and 1% of 12th graders reported using heroin in the past year

As observed from 2002 onward, cigarette smoking in the past month was less prevalent among adults who were college graduates compared with those with less education. Among adults aged 18 or older, current cigarette use in 2008 was reported by 34.4 percent of those who had not completed high school, 30.6 percent of high school graduates who did not attend college, 26.6 percent of persons with some college, and 14.0 percent of college graduates.
